In South Sumter, SC, cladding service planning usually begins with lap exposure checks, substrate flatness notes, and a fastener schedule that matches manufacturer tables.
Technicians separate tear-off volume, disposal bands, and re-install sequencing so corners, transitions, and utility trims in South Sumter, SC stay aligned with the approved scope.
Our intake language for cladding service work emphasizes measurable tolerances: expansion gaps, clip spacing, and WRB counter-laps rather than vague one-line bids.
FAQ: When should panels be staged? In South Sumter, SC, staging often tracks material acclimation windows, wind forecasts, and driveway access around ZIP 29150.
Tip: Photograph existing courses, starter alignment, and any soft sheathing near openings before demolition starts in the Sumter County grid.
